Concerts in Africa⁚ A Vibrant Landscape of Music
Africa is a continent brimming with musical talent and passion‚ and this energy translates into a thriving live music scene. From the bustling metropolises to remote villages‚ concerts and music festivals are bringing people together‚ celebrating diverse cultures‚ and showcasing the continent's unique musical heritage. This dynamic landscape is fueled by a growing appreciation for live music‚ a rising middle class with disposable income‚ and a surge in international artists touring the continent.
The Rise of Live Music in South Africa
South Africa stands as a beacon of live music in Africa‚ boasting a vibrant and diverse scene that caters to a wide range of tastes. This growth is fueled by a number of factors‚ including a thriving music industry‚ a passionate fanbase‚ and a flourishing tourism sector. The country has become a popular destination for international artists‚ drawn by its large‚ enthusiastic audiences and state-of-the-art venues.
The rise of live music in South Africa can be attributed to several key drivers⁚
- A Strong Music Industry⁚ South Africa boasts a rich musical heritage‚ with a thriving music industry that produces a steady stream of talented artists across genres. This vibrant music scene provides a solid foundation for live music events.
- A Passionate Fanbase⁚ South Africans have a deep love for music‚ evident in the massive crowds that flock to concerts and festivals. This passionate fanbase creates a strong demand for live music experiences.
- Growing Tourism⁚ South Africa's tourism sector is booming‚ attracting visitors from all over the world. This influx of tourists adds to the demand for entertainment‚ including live music events‚ further boosting the industry.
- Investment in Infrastructure⁚ The country has made significant investments in its concert venues and infrastructure‚ creating world-class facilities that can accommodate large-scale events.
The result is a dynamic and thriving live music scene in South Africa‚ where both local and international artists find enthusiastic audiences. This trend is set to continue‚ with more and more events being planned and larger crowds attending concerts and festivals.
Major Concert Venues and Events
South Africa's live music scene thrives on a network of iconic venues and major events that draw huge crowds and showcase the best in local and international talent. These venues offer diverse settings‚ from large stadiums to intimate theaters‚ catering to various musical tastes. Here are some of the most prominent concert venues and events in South Africa⁚
- FNB Stadium (Soweto‚ Johannesburg)⁚ Known as the "Soccer City" stadium‚ this massive venue has hosted numerous concerts by international superstars like Beyoncé‚ Jay-Z‚ and Justin Bieber‚ drawing tens of thousands of fans.
- Grand Arena (GrandWest‚ Cape Town)⁚ This versatile venue‚ located within a popular entertainment complex‚ hosts a wide range of musical events‚ from rock and pop concerts to classical performances.
- SunBet Arena (Time Square Casino‚ Pretoria)⁚ This multi-purpose arena‚ known for its modern design‚ is a popular destination for concerts and other events‚ hosting acts like James Blunt and Kool & The Gang.
- DHL Stadium (Cape Town)⁚ This stadium‚ primarily used for rugby‚ is increasingly hosting concerts‚ attracting large crowds to performances by artists like Justin Bieber.
- Teatro at Montecasino (Johannesburg)⁚ This intimate theater‚ known for its sophisticated ambiance‚ offers a unique setting for live music‚ hosting both local and international artists.
Beyond individual venues‚ South Africa hosts several major music festivals that draw crowds from across the country and beyond. These festivals celebrate diverse musical genres‚ from electronic music to traditional African sounds‚ providing a platform for both established and emerging artists⁚
- Cape Town Country Festival⁚ This annual event‚ held in October‚ brings together country music fans for a weekend of performances by top artists.
- Calabash⁚ This summer music festival‚ held in various locations across the country‚ features a mix of genres‚ including pop‚ rock‚ and hip-hop.
These venues and festivals create a vibrant hub for live music in South Africa‚ attracting both local and international artists and fans alike.
Music Festivals Across the Continent
Beyond South Africa‚ music festivals across the African continent are exploding in popularity‚ showcasing the continent's diverse musical heritage and attracting a growing global audience. These festivals offer a unique blend of music‚ culture‚ and community‚ bringing together artists and fans from different backgrounds to celebrate the power of music.
Here are some of the most notable music festivals in Africa⁚
- Sauti za Busara (Zanzibar‚ Tanzania)⁚ Held annually in February‚ this festival celebrates East African music‚ featuring a diverse lineup of artists from across the region. Beyond the music‚ it provides a platform for cultural exchange and showcases the beauty of Zanzibar.
- Festac (Lagos‚ Nigeria)⁚ This festival‚ held in Lagos‚ Nigeria‚ is a major celebration of African culture‚ music‚ and arts‚ featuring a diverse lineup of artists from across the continent and beyond.
- Accra Electronic Music Festival (Accra‚ Ghana)⁚ This festival‚ held in Accra‚ Ghana‚ is a celebration of electronic music‚ featuring DJs and producers from Ghana and around the world.
- Le Festival au Desert (Mali)⁚ This festival‚ held in the Sahara Desert‚ is a celebration of Tuareg music and culture‚ featuring traditional music and dance performances.
These festivals are not only a source of entertainment but also play a vital role in promoting cultural exchange‚ fostering economic growth‚ and showcasing the talent of African musicians to a global audience. The growing popularity of these festivals is a testament to the dynamism and vibrancy of the African music scene.
Beyond South Africa⁚ Concerts in Other African Countries
While South Africa leads the way in terms of concert infrastructure and international artist tours‚ the live music scene is flourishing across the African continent. From vibrant capitals to bustling cities and remote villages‚ music lovers are gathering to celebrate their diverse musical heritage.
InEast Africa‚ the bustling city ofKampala‚ Uganda‚ is home to a thriving music scene‚ with artists like Jose Chameleone drawing large crowds to their concerts.Zanzibar‚ Tanzania‚ hosts the renowned Sauti za Busara festival‚ attracting both local and international music fans.
West Africa boasts a rich musical tradition‚ withLagos‚ Nigeria‚ emerging as a major hub for live music‚ hosting a variety of concerts and festivals.Accra‚ Ghana‚ is also home to a vibrant music scene‚ with the Accra Electronic Music Festival attracting fans of electronic music from across the continent.
North Africa‚ with its unique blend of traditional and contemporary music‚ is seeing a growing interest in live music.Marrakech‚ Morocco‚ is a popular destination for concerts‚ showcasing a mix of local and international artists.
The live music scene inCentral Africa is developing rapidly‚ with cities likeKinshasa‚ Democratic Republic of Congo‚ andYaoundé‚ Cameroon‚ hosting a growing number of concerts and festivals.
Southern Africa‚ beyond South Africa‚ is also seeing a rise in live music events.Lusaka‚ Zambia‚ andHarare‚ Zimbabwe‚ are attracting a growing number of artists and fans‚ with concerts and festivals becoming increasingly popular.
The live music scene in Africa is a dynamic and diverse landscape‚ reflecting the continent's rich cultural heritage and growing appreciation for music. As the continent continues to develop‚ live music is poised to play an even greater role in bringing people together‚ fostering cultural exchange‚ and promoting economic growth.
The Impact of Concerts SA and Music In Africa
Two key organizations‚ Concerts SA and Music In Africa‚ are making a significant impact on the live music scene across the continent‚ fostering growth‚ development‚ and sustainability. They play crucial roles in supporting artists‚ promoting events‚ and connecting music professionals.
- Concerts SA⁚ Founded in 2014‚ Concerts SA is a non-profit organization dedicated to supporting the South African live music industry. It provides funding‚ training‚ and mentorship to artists and event organizers‚ helping them to develop sustainable careers and grow their businesses. Concerts SA has played a vital role in promoting live music events across South Africa‚ contributing to the thriving scene the country is known for.
- Music In Africa⁚ This non-profit initiative‚ launched in 2008‚ is a leading resource for information and exchange in the African music sector. It provides a platform for artists‚ industry professionals‚ and music fans to connect‚ share information‚ and collaborate. Music In Africa's website and digital platforms are valuable resources for those seeking to learn about the African music scene‚ find opportunities‚ and stay up-to-date on the latest developments.
These organizations are helping to build a more vibrant and sustainable live music scene in Africa‚ creating opportunities for artists‚ promoting cultural exchange‚ and connecting music professionals across the continent. Their work is crucial to the continued growth and development of the African music landscape.
Looking Ahead⁚ The Future of Concerts in Africa
The future of concerts in Africa looks bright‚ fueled by a growing appreciation for live music‚ a burgeoning middle class with disposable income‚ and a surge in international artist tours. The continent's vibrant musical heritage and the increasing popularity of music festivals are further driving this trend.
Here are some key factors shaping the future of concerts in Africa⁚
- Infrastructure Development⁚ Continued investment in concert venues and infrastructure will be crucial for hosting larger events and attracting international artists. This includes building new venues‚ upgrading existing ones‚ and improving transportation and logistics.
- Technology and Innovation⁚ The rise of streaming platforms and online ticketing systems is transforming the way people access and experience live music. Technology will play an increasingly important role in promoting events‚ connecting artists and fans‚ and delivering innovative experiences.
- Cultural Exchange⁚ Music festivals will continue to play a vital role in promoting cultural exchange‚ bringing together artists and fans from different backgrounds to celebrate the diversity of African music.
- Economic Growth⁚ As Africa's economy continues to grow‚ the demand for entertainment‚ including live music‚ is likely to increase. This will create more opportunities for artists‚ event organizers‚ and businesses in the music industry.
The future of concerts in Africa is exciting and full of potential. As the continent continues to develop‚ live music will play a vital role in bringing people together‚ fostering cultural exchange‚ and driving economic growth. The vibrant and dynamic landscape of concerts in Africa is only going to become more exciting and diverse in the years to come.
